    AI for Defense and Intelligence is a timely and compelling read for graduate students interested in this rapidly-growing field, mid-career professionals looking to rebrand, and senior leaders in federal agencies who want to get smart on the latest tech. This approachable and focused book provides an overview of AI basics, a review of powerful machine learning models, and a discussion of applications across natural language processing (NLP), computer vision (CV), optimization, agent-based modeling and more. Readers will learn about contemporary defense and intelligence programs leveraging AI for mission advantage. The book also details challenges and solutions for scaling AI in the cloud, training models at scale, customizing AI for unique mission applications, and addressing hard problems endemic to defense and intelligence missions. The book quotes extensively from current research and government documents, providing the student with a strong basis for a career applying AI in support of national security.

    This authoritative resource presents the underpinnings and applications in the emerging discipline of activity-based intelligence (ABI). This book defines, clarifies, and demystifies the tradecraft of ABI by providing concise definitions, clear examples, and thoughtful discussion.

    This book offers a comprehensive overview of ABI's principles and methods - developed by the U.S. Intelligence Community - and how they apply to intelligence analysis. Readers find insight into the evolution of intelligence in an era of dynamic change and diverse threats. Practicing professionals will gain an in-depth understanding of ABI and how it can be applied to real-world problems.

  • Edwin Land Industry Award

    Intelligence and National Security Alliance (INSA)

    The Edwin H. Land Industry Award recognizes the accomplishments of early- and mid-career
    professionals who work in industry on intelligence, defense, and homeland security issues. Industry
    organizations include private companies, as well as National Labs, FFRDCs, and other organizations
    that perform work under contract for the government.
